The only ones still left from season one that I know of are Zaphod and Daisy. The difference in Daisy's and Mozart's fates comes down to simply this: Mozart dreamed of being a queen like her mother. But the Kalahari is especially cruel to thwarted ambition. It's a "winner take all" world, and because Mozy never quite succeeded as an apha, she paid with her life for her dream. Daisy, on the other hand, is alive because she was willing to submit to the family.
